What is the Authorization for Nonprescription Medication?
The Authorization for Nonprescription Medication form serves as a critical document for parents or guardians in Martinsville City Public Schools. This form authorizes the administration of nonprescription medication to students during school hours, ensuring proper health management. It requires necessary signatures from both the parent or guardian and the school nurse to validate the request.

Eligibility Criteria for the Authorization for Nonprescription Medication
To qualify for signing the authorization form, a parent or guardian must be a legal custodian of the child. Nonprescription medications may include treatments for allergies, minor pain relief, or cold symptoms, depending on individual health needs. Each school within Martinsville may have specific guidelines regarding the types of medications permitted, so it is essential to review these prior to submission.
